Output af560287bfc384a481acbdd8e4d6b328e65c2db4213c953a15af2d61b53eb4a3:0

value
3091396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64c85e7483557cdb95fb8e65538a4dcbeac27446 OP_EQUAL
address
3AsuXc8mjVytm97nQS18aWzaQMtL7mcGFX
transaction
af560287bfc384a481acbdd8e4d6b328e65c2db4213c953a15af2d61b53eb4a3
confirmations
281952
spent
true